Devastation hit La Plata in 2002 when a tornado completely wiped out the town. Massive recovery and rebuilding efforts eventually erased all evidence of the damage inflicted by the tornado, leading to a stronger, closer community as well as a more beautiful La Plata.
The La Plata community bonds over a wide variety of family-friendly events, including the La Plata Bed Races, Celebrate La Plata, Kids Summer Shows, Summer Concert Series, Fall Festival, Harvest Halloween Party, Veterans Parade, and Breakfast with Santa. A broad range of local businesses along Charles Street contribute to the small-town flavor of La Plata while several nearby parks and nature preserves offer La Plata residents plenty of outdoor recreational opportunities. Metropolitan amenities abound in nearby Waldorf, DC, and Baltimore.
